This is the ferry ticket of Hailian, Kangaroo Island Ferry Ticket [Attraction Introduction] Cliffordshoney Farm, Kangaroo Island has organic honey produced by the world's only surviving purebred Ligurian bees (ligurianbees).
The bee was introduced from Italy, but its native species is extinct and the only fruit left on Kangaroo Island remains. Here you can learn about the production process of organic honey, the breeding process of bees, and the production of honey. These organic honeys contain a very low glycemic index, the lower the glycemic index. The slower the body absorbs and digests, the more healthy sugars can be fully absorbed by the body's bloodstream.
SealbayConversationParkSea Lion Bay is known for its large colony of Australian sea lions, the only place in Australia where visitors can get up close and personal with sea lions on the beach. In the first half of the 20th century, shark fishing boats used to arbitrarily kill sea lions and seals as bait for shark hunting, leading to a sharp decline in sea lion populations.
Because there are reefs in the waters near Seal Bay, which cannot be approached by sea boats, the Australian sea lions here have survived. In 1954, the Seal Bay Waters Reserve was established. Currently, there are about 600 sea lions in the area. Flinderschase National ParkFlinderschase National Park is one of Australia's largest parks.
With an area of 74,000 hectares, it is native to Australia. Sanctuary for animals such as kangaroos, mini kangaroos, koalas, and echidnas. The park is home to a wide variety of native flora, as well as nature's masterpieces, the RemarkableRocks and the Admiralsarch.

Driving is the only reliable way to get around. 【Attraction Introduction】Mount LoftyThe Lovti Range is the gateway to the Adelaide Mountains with towering peaks on the edge of the Adelaide Plains. The summit is located on an area of 1,000 hectares in the Cleland Natural Conservation Area.
Overlooking the expansive city of Adelaide. German Village of Hahndorf (GermantownofHahndorf) The small town of Hahndorf is Australia's oldest surviving German settlement. It has been more than 170 years since Prussians and East Germans settled here in 1839. Many of the buildings along the street still retain the German charm of 100 years ago.
Many restaurants and pubs also offer tempting traditional German dishes such as German sausages, pork knuckles, and beer. In addition, there are many galleries, craft shops and souvenir shops along the street. Well worth a visit. GewildlifePark is a privately owned safari park where the owner has adopted a lot of stray critters.
and the rare animals that the zoo owners collected and brought back from their travels around the world. There is also a free koala hugging program for tourists. The Barossa Echo Wall (WhisperingWall) The WhisperingWall is the reserved wall of the Barossa Reservoir. The dam was built between 1899 and 1903 and was a feat of construction at the time.
